How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Middlesex?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Middlesex Studio Apartments | $1,285 | $1,175 | $1,360 |
Middlesex 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,331 | $870 | $1,913 |
Middlesex 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,623 | $950 | $2,965 |
Middlesex 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,932 | $1,070 | $2,744 |
Middlesex 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,493 | $1,800 | $3,680 |

Frequently Asked Questions about New Middlesex Apartments
What is the Cheapest New apartment in Middlesex?
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Middlesex is at Riverwood Villas listed at $1,075.
How much is the average rent for a New Middlesex Apartment?
The average rent for a New Apartment in Middlesex is $1,824.
What is the largest New Middlesex Apartment for rent?
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Middlesex is a 2,511 square feet unit starting from $2,295 at Summerwell Harmony.
What is the average size for Middlesex New Apartments for rent?
The average size for a New rental in Middlesex is currently at 848 sq ft.
